Output 852cdaa23e724dc57b1d5e7f025cbca8f5d9d3ff3d19c7ef01646836b772ef99:1

value
17667927
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8698e71d9aa29f1514d69d1065d1e284832eaaaa OP_EQUALVERIFY OP_CHECKSIG
address
1DGgiaWZrkeUpyZ1j9PhRzfj3XYSWuSVFp
transaction
852cdaa23e724dc57b1d5e7f025cbca8f5d9d3ff3d19c7ef01646836b772ef99
spent
true